Primary Care Internist - Hingham

Located on the Hingham Harbor in the new development called the Launch ... which is a multi-use facility with shops, dining, office space and the Brigham and Women's Primary Care. Excellent opportunity to join Brigham and Women's Primary Care south of Boston. Full or part-time FTE.

We are searching for a board certified or eligible physician to join our friendly, busy and well-established practice. This position would see adults only. This physician group provides health screening, comprehensive diagnostic work-ups, treatment and long-term care. We offer:

BWH Primary Care provides comprehensive adult medical care for over 200,000 patients across our sixteen primary care practices throughout the greater Boston area. Our facilities are modern and patient-centered, with high-caliber clinical and support staff teams. Our PCPs see a complete range of adult patients across all demographics and diseases and conditions. Our growing network of primary care practices in eastern Massachusetts is testimony to Brigham and Women's commitment to primary care as a critical component of managing populations, and our dedication to providing the best experience and health outcomes for our patients.
